Southern Tier Old Man, Strip Steak, Roasted Broccoli


The beer is Southern Tier's Old Man. The food is strip steak with a vaguely Italian-ish pan sauce, with a side dish probably described as oven-blackened broccoli with pine nuts and mustardy vinaigrette. The beer played rather nicely with the vinous pan sauce (since the pan sauce has a good bit of sherry in it, vinous is an expected characteristic), and the pretty assertive hopping for an old ale bounced well off the little bit of peppery heat from the spice rub I used. The roasty and toasty threads in the beer played well with the very caramelized broccoli and the slightly less browned steak. Pretty tasty, all in all; I thought for a while about what beer was going to work with this, and Old Man turned out to be a solid choice.
